Output 376f26d7eeec78071313f071cff45140634fc91002edffd52bf878f4ffe84497:23

value
594567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f8c51650131e4751eb2724c093dd975baefa15 OP_EQUAL
address
3BMLtX6PD47pz3vNpGRHjEDvjwa1ydHxxo
transaction
376f26d7eeec78071313f071cff45140634fc91002edffd52bf878f4ffe84497
spent
true